Teen Mom’s Ryan Edwards and Girlfriend Amanda Conner Expecting First Baby Together

The Teen Mom family is gaining a new member.
Ryan Edwards—who appeared on season one of the MTV reality series alongside ex Maci Bookout—is expecting his first baby with girlfriend Amanda Conner, who shared the news on social media.
In an Oct. 4 TikTok video, The Teen Mom: The Next Chapter star zoomed in on her stomach, while Ryan rubbed his hand over her growing bump and planted a kiss near her belly button.
And Amanda—who has been dating Ryan since September 2023—provided insight into how her pregnancy journey has been going so far. Two days later, she shared that she's "working" on giving up vaping as she preps for the little one's arrival, and she responded to a question about her experience with morning sickness.
“Have you had any 'morning' sickness during your pregnancy?" one user asked in the comments of her Oct. 7 TikTok video . "Omg girl, I was so sick I thought I was gonna [die].. don’t know how I lived through both!!"
Amanda replied, "Same!! This has been a rough pregnancy."
And while the couple's announcement marks their first time welcoming a baby together, it's neither of their first times becoming parents. Amanda is also mom to a son from a previous relationship, while Ryan shares son Bentley, 15, with Maci, as well as son Jagger, 5, and daughter Stella, 4, with his estranged wife Mackenzie Edwards.
And as for how Maci feels about their blended family expanding even further? The 33-year-old only has good things to say about co-parenting with Amanda and Ryan, who's been on a sobriety journey since overdosing in September 2023.
"All of us involved have done a whole lot of work,” Maci—who also shares daughter Jayde, 9, and Maverick, 8, with husband Taylor McKinney—told E! News in June. “We have just honestly worked on ourselves. So, naturally, it's all coming together."
Noting that it's "really cool to see" Amanda and Ryan grow together, she added, "I'm really proud of them."
